Recipes and menus for all seasons. 46 p. 1960s

Mixed Materials 314, Folder 11

Item [11] promotes Sexton quality foods. Includes message from Jean M. Kenison, home economist; menus for spring, summer, fall, and winter; recipes for breads, salads, meats, vegetables, and desserts; food serving charts; cost per serving, milk conversion, and egg equivalent tables; advertisement for Sexton cleaning chemicals, including Defenso and Tremendso; image of woman in period dress; and laid-in printed history of the U.S. Foodservice from 2006. Sample recipes: pumpkin cup cakes, prune rolled wheat bread, and tuna pizza.

Shop by mail & recipe book : Cross Imports. 66 p. 1980

Mixed Materials 314, Folder 17

Item [17] promotes Cross Imports, Inc. Includes message from Mark Cross; catalog of products, including cookie cutters, pots and pans, and kitchen utensils; descriptions, images, and prices for each product; and recipes for breads, meats, vegetables, and desserts. Sample recipes: pizzelles, Sylvia's stuffed zucchini, and Elaine's apricot chicken.
